Forbes says Kim Kardashian is not a billionaire yet after Kanye West congratulated her on becoming one

Forbes has shut down reports that Kim Kardashian is now a billionaire after she sold 20 percent stake of her beauty line to American multinational beauty company, COTY, for $200 million.

According to Forbes, the 39-year-old reality star and mother of four is worth about $900million after inking a deal with Coty Inc. to sell a 20 percent stake in the company, which sells make-up and fragrances, for $200million

Forbes writes that the deal values KKW Beauty at $1 billion, not that she is one yet, but close. 

The outlet estimates that Kim has a 72 percent stake in the company now (majority ownership) and that her mother Kris Jenner owns an 8 percent stake.

626 new cases of Coronavirus recorded in Nigeria


626 new cases of Coronavirus recorded in Nigeria
Nigeria on Thursday July 2, recorded 626 new cases of Coronavirus as confirmed in a tweet shared by the Nigeria Centre for Disease Control (NCDC). 

A breakdown of the new cases across different states in the country is as follows; Lagos-193, FCT-85, Oyo-41, Edo-38, Kwara-34, Abia-31, Ogun-29, Ondo-28, Rivers-26, Osun-21, Akwa Ibom-18, Delta-18, Enugu-15, Kaduna-13, Plateau-11, Borno-8, Bauchi-7, Adamawa-5, Gombe-4, Sokoto-1. 

As at July 2, there are 27,110 confirmed cases of Coronavirus in the country. 10,801 patients have been discharged and 616 deaths has been recorded.
